Andrei Dokukin, MD

Diplomat of American Board of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ation & American Board of Pain Medicine

Dr. Andrei N. Dokukin is a Board Certified Physiatrist (MD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ation) who also has been fellowship trained in Spine and Interventional Pain Medicine as well as Musculoskeletal Medicine.

Dr. Dokukin earned his Bachelor of Arts degree from City University of New York Hunter College. He received his medical training at the State University of New York Downstate Medical Center in Brooklyn, where he also completed one year of training in Internal Medicine. His residency training in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ation took place in Montefiore Medical Center Albert Einstein School of Medicine in the Bronx, N.Y. where he also served as a Chief Resident. Dr. Dokukin completed his Pain Fellowship under Dr. Francis P. Lagattuta in Santa Maria California.

Dr. Dokukin uses minimally invasive techniques with the help of ultrasound, fluoroscopy (X-rays), and electromyography guidance to treat vast variety of diseases of joints, nerves, and bones and muscles that produce pain. He also specializes in treating disease and painful conditions of the spine. His scope of practice includes testing for the disorder of nerves and muscles by using Electrodiagnostic Medicine known as Nerve Conduction Studies and Electromyography. His expertise in Rehabilitation medicine gives him an edge on treating people with disabilities that may result from amputation, strokes, or brain injuries.

Dr. Dokukin also has a special interest in Performing Arts medicine, and has experience in treating dancers and musicians. Dr. Dokukin’s special interest in Musculoskeletal Medicine and Performing Arts Medicine originates from his previous career of a professional ballet dancer. He experienced many of the injuries firsthand during his training in the Bolshoi Ballet Academy in Moscow, Russia and The Juilliard School in New York, as well as touring and performing with the American Ballet Theatre. This experience adds to his understanding of musculoskeletal disorders and their impact on patient’s career and lifestyle

Dr. Dokukin is currently serving as an attending physician in Roots Through Recovery in Long Beach, California. He has a private practice located primarily in Orange County Newport Beach and Long Beach, CA. He volunteers as a company physician of Orange County Ballet Theater, as well as in the Dance Department of California State College of Long Beach. He is a member of the American Academy of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ation, the American Academy of Pain Medicie, the American Association of Neuromuscular and Electrodiagnostic Medicine, and the Performing Arts Medicine Association.

On the recent launch of www.LiverRecovery.com

Alcohol use disorder may lead to life threatening at times life ending consequences. One of the organs that is most commonly affected is the liver. Unfortunately, despite the amazing advances in modern medicine, end stage disease of the liver can only be definitively addressed with liver transplantation. We have very limited medical therapies that help to address liver recovery.

I come from the part of the World where alcohol use disorder continues to be rampant. This led to development of multiple herbal products that are designed to treat alcohol use disorder and liver disease caused by it. These products are not available in the US and are not FDA approved to treat liver disease in the US. Nevertheless, these herbal supplements are powerful tools that have been used in Europe and Russia for a very long time. These are simply the best tools we have short of stem-cell therapies and liver transplantation to help with regenerating liver function.
